Injury update: Hahn, Hopson

1358286.jpeg1358287.jpeg

Maine coaches are hoping either Chris Hahn (broken jaw) or Keenan Hopson (shoulder) will be cleared to play by next weekend's series with New Hampshire.

Maine is off today. Both will practice in non-contact jersey's Wednesday and be re-evaluated.

Hahn has had some serious bad luck this year. He originally broke his finger back in December, returned to practice and took a puck in the jaw. He did not have to have his jaw wired shut, but it is broken.

"It wasn’t even hard. It was kind of a dump in scenario," said Maine Coach Tim Whitehead. "It was kind of a freaky accident. Unfortunately he’s had some tough luck."

Whitehead said there is little chance either could play this weekend at UMass-Lowell or Massachusetts.

"It's very unlikely that either will be cleared to play but we're hoping at the very least they can keep their cardio and legs going, stay in shape so there's a possibility to be cleared for the UNH series," said Whitehead.

Billy Ryan (hip) is also not practicing.
